| import argparse |
| import glob |
| import gyp_crashpad |
| import os |
| import re |
| import subprocess |
| import sys |
| |
| |
| def main(args): |
| parser = argparse.ArgumentParser( |
| description='Set up an Android cross build', |
| epilog='Additional arguments will be passed to gyp_crashpad.py.') |
| parser.add_argument('--ndk', required=True, help='Standalone NDK toolchain') |
| parser.add_argument('--compiler', |
| default='clang', |
| choices=('clang', 'gcc'), |
| help='The compiler to use, clang by default') |
| (parsed, extra_command_line_args) = parser.parse_known_args(args) |
| |
| NDK_ERROR=( |
| 'NDK must be a valid standalone NDK toolchain.\n' + |
| 'See https://developer.android.com/ndk/guides/standalone_toolchain.html') |
| arch_dirs = glob.glob(os.path.join(parsed.ndk, '*-linux-android*')) |
| if len(arch_dirs) != 1: |
| parser.error(NDK_ERROR) |
| |
| arch_triplet = os.path.basename(arch_dirs[0]) |
| ARCH_TRIPLET_TO_ARCH = { |
| 'arm-linux-androideabi': 'arm', |
| 'aarch64-linux-android': 'arm64', |
| 'i686-linux-android': 'ia32', |
| 'x86_64-linux-android': 'x64', |
| 'mipsel-linux-android': 'mips', |
| 'mips64el-linux-android': 'mips64', |
| } |
| if arch_triplet not in ARCH_TRIPLET_TO_ARCH: |
| parser.error(NDK_ERROR) |
| arch = ARCH_TRIPLET_TO_ARCH[arch_triplet] |
| |
| ndk_bin_dir = os.path.join(parsed.ndk, 'bin') |
| |
| clang_path = os.path.join(ndk_bin_dir, 'clang') |
| extra_args = [] |
| |
| if parsed.compiler == 'clang': |
| os.environ['CC_target'] = clang_path |
| os.environ['CXX_target'] = os.path.join(ndk_bin_dir, 'clang++') |
| elif parsed.compiler == 'gcc': |
| os.environ['CC_target'] = os.path.join(ndk_bin_dir, |
| '%s-gcc' % arch_triplet) |
| os.environ['CXX_target'] = os.path.join(ndk_bin_dir, |
| '%s-g++' % arch_triplet) |
| |
| # Unlike the Clang build, when using GCC with unified headers, __ANDROID_API__ |
| # isn’t set automatically and must be pushed in to the build. Fish the correct |
| # value out of the Clang wrapper script. If deprecated headers are in use, the |
| # Clang wrapper won’t mention __ANDROID_API__, but the standalone toolchain’s |
| # <android/api-level.h> will #define it for both Clang and GCC. |
| # |
| # android_api_level is extracted in this manner even when compiling with Clang |
| # so that it’s available for use in GYP conditions that need to test the API |
| # level, but beware that it’ll only be available when unified headers are in |
| # use. |
| # |
| # Unified headers are the way of the future, according to |
| # https://android.googlesource.com/platform/ndk/+/ndk-r14/CHANGELOG.md and |
| # https://android.googlesource.com/platform/ndk/+/master/docs/UnifiedHeaders.md. |
| # Traditional (deprecated) headers have been removed entirely as of NDK r16. |
| # https://android.googlesource.com/platform/ndk/+/ndk-release-r16/CHANGELOG.md. |
| with open(clang_path, 'r') as file: |
| clang_script_contents = file.read() |
| matches = re.finditer(r'\s-D__ANDROID_API__=([\d]+)\s', |
| clang_script_contents) |
| match = next(matches, None) |
| if match: |
| android_api = int(match.group(1)) |
| extra_args.extend(['-D', 'android_api_level=%d' % android_api]) |
| if next(matches, None): |
| raise AssertionError('__ANDROID_API__ defined too many times') |
| |
| for tool in ('ar', 'nm', 'readelf'): |
| os.environ['%s_target' % tool.upper()] = ( |
| os.path.join(ndk_bin_dir, '%s-%s' % (arch_triplet, tool))) |
| |
| return gyp_crashpad.main( |
| ['-D', 'OS=android', |
| '-D', 'target_arch=%s' % arch, |
| '-D', 'clang=%d' % (1 if parsed.compiler == 'clang' else 0), |
| '-f', 'ninja-android'] + |
| extra_args + |
| extra_command_line_args) |
| |
| |
| if __name__ == '__main__': |
| sys.exit(main(sys.argv[1:])) |
